One Degree Organic Foods Sprouted Supergrain Granola
At a glance
Summary
This granola features several beneficial ingredients such as sprouted oats, quinoa, and chia seeds, which provide fiber, protein, and essential nutrients. However, the presence of organic expeller-pressed sunflower oil, a seed oil high in omega-6 fatty acids, is a concern due to its potential to promote inflammation. The product is processed, which limits its score despite the overall clean ingredient list.

Organic QuinoaVery Good
Quinoa is a complete protein source containing all essential amino acids. It is also high in fiber and various vitamins and minerals. Being organic ensures it is free from synthetic pesticides.
Benefits
Provides a complete protein source and is rich in fiber, supporting muscle health and digestion.
Sprouted Organic Gluten-Free OatsGood
Sprouted oats are a nutritious whole grain that provide fiber and essential nutrients. The sprouting process enhances nutrient absorption and digestibility. Being organic and gluten-free adds to their health benefits.
Benefits
Rich in fiber, which supports digestive health and helps maintain stable blood sugar levels.
Organic Chia SeedsGood
Chia seeds are rich in omega-3 fatty acids, fiber, and antioxidants. They support heart health and provide sustained energy. Being organic ensures they are free from harmful chemicals.
Benefits
High in omega-3 fatty acids, which support cardiovascular health and reduce inflammation.
Organic Date SyrupGood
Date syrup is a natural sweetener made from whole dates, retaining fiber and nutrients. It has a lower glycemic index compared to refined sugars. Being organic ensures it is free from synthetic additives.
Benefits
Contains natural sugars along with fiber and nutrients, offering a healthier alternative to refined sugars.
Unrefined SaltGood
Unrefined salt contains trace minerals that are beneficial for health. It is less processed than refined table salt, retaining its natural mineral content. It provides essential sodium needed for various bodily functions.
